Brown Rice Family
WQXR’s weeknight host and the emcee of the annual “Battle of the Boroughs” from The Greene Space at WNYC and WQXR, Terrance McKnight curates and hosts this evening of music for BAMcafé Live. BROWN RICE FAMILY, winner of the 2012 “Battle of the Boroughs” creates organic world-roots music that stems from jazz, Afro-beat, reggae, rock, Latin rhythms, hip-hop, and funk. Based in Brooklyn, the band features eight members from around the world—Japan, Jamaica, Haiti, Nigeria, South Africa, and the US. The members’ diverse national backgrounds set the stage for their unique coexistence and musical creativity.
